    Great bbq joint in McGregor Texas. You can tell it's great by the plethora of locals who are…read morevisiting here during lunch. The pricing here is not out of this world like some other BBQ joints. They are very reasonably priced for BBQ. As for the meats they are delicious! Everything we ordered was smoked well, and you could see the smoke ring in the brisket. I do have to say that the brisket, ribs and ham were my favs. The BBQ sauce was pretty tasty as well and went well with everything. The sides were normal BBQ sides, nothing really blowing my mind on that one. As for the service the lady at the counter was very friendly and explained it all to me as to what was what. Super nice. The atmosphere here is of a local hole in the wall BBQ joint. You see local high school helmets. Wooden floors and chairs, tables. You can tell this place has been here for a while. They are not trying to be fancy, they are a trying to be a BBQ joint in a small Texas town. I have to say they are delivering on that. Overall a great BBQ experience. I would check them out during lunch sometime.

    Quaint little hole in the wall off I-35. Super reasonable prices, I think the most expensive item…read moreon the menu was $13 and that includes two sides AND the drink. They have a daily special on the white board, I got the fried pork chops with baked beans and mashed potatoes plus a delicious iceberg lettuce side salad for 9.99. Everything was delicious. There was a comment above about the waitresses not staying long. Being in a tiny little town that's not exactly affluent, and only two tables occupied during my entire visit, I suspect the tips are atrocious. Waitresses only make like $2/hr and depend on tips for the rest of their income. My waitresses was here by herself besides the cook, she was responsible for waiting plus clearing tables, washing the dishes, manning the checkout, literally everything except the actual cooking. She's been here three days and did a very good job considering she is brand new. I hope she stays. She spent several minutes talking to me about my current trip, checked on me regularly, and checked me out accurately and quickly. Carlos is the cook. He makes some damn good fried pork chops! Overall a great experience. Would recommend.
